Output 51e96e21eeba905cc69df033d8c5e415fdd0979938e965a2ee486d0e0e598b2e:1

value
13034
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 56ee38026d8edf90b670bed64dfdd76d4df71f466db7e05c079ad41d1451abeb
address
bc1p2mhrsqnd3m0epdnshmtymlwhd4xlw86xdkm7qhq8nt2p69z3404s723ggq
transaction
51e96e21eeba905cc69df033d8c5e415fdd0979938e965a2ee486d0e0e598b2e
spent
true